当前位置: 首页 > news >正文

礼品回收网站建设wordpress播放歌

礼品回收网站建设,wordpress播放歌,html的网站模板,汕头中企动力目录 1. 单身狗12. 单身狗2 1. 单身狗1 题目如下#xff1a; 思路#xff1a;一部分人可能会使用对数组排序#xff0c;遍历数组的方式去找出只出现一次的数字#xff0c;但这种方法的时间复杂度过高#xff0c;有时候可能会不满足要求。 有一种十分简便的方法是使用异或… 目录 1. 单身狗12. 单身狗2 1. 单身狗1 题目如下 思路一部分人可能会使用对数组排序遍历数组的方式去找出只出现一次的数字但这种方法的时间复杂度过高有时候可能会不满足要求。 有一种十分简便的方法是使用异或运算 代码实现如下 #include stdio.hint main() {int arr[] { 1,2,3,4,5,1,2,3,4 };int num 0;int sz sizeof(arr) / sizeof(arr[0]);for (int i 0; i sz; i){num ^ arr[i];}printf(%d\n, num);return 0; }2. 单身狗2 题目如下 思路通过上面的题目我们不难想到如果我们可以把数组中的数据分离开再分别进行异或就可以找出那两个数字。 代码实现如下 #include stdio.hint main() {int arr[] { 1,2,3,4,5,1,2,3,4,6 };int sz sizeof(arr) / sizeof(arr[0]);int num 0;//1.整体异或结果就是两个不同数字的异或结果 5^6for (int i 0; i sz; i){num ^ arr[i];}//2.找到5^6倒数第k位为1int k 0;for (int i 0; i 32; i){if (((num k) 1) 1){k i;break;}}//3.根据倒数第k位为1或0把全部数字分开再分别异或int p1 0;int p2 0;for (int i 0; i sz; i){if (((arr[i] k) 1) 1){p1 ^ arr[i];}else{p2 ^ arr[i];}}printf(%d %d, p1, p2);return 0; }
http://www.zqtcl.cn/news/323359/

相关文章:

  • 泉州模板开发建站wordpress显示一个类目
  • 河南造价信息网官网为什么要做网站优化
  • 网站做个seo要多少钱做公司网站开发的公司
  • 企业网站html模板下载安装的字体wordpress
  • 庙行镇seo推广网站朋友圈的广告推广怎么弄
  • 网站打不开怎么办html怎么做网站背景
  • 厦门网站排名网络服务类型有哪些
  • 如何选择制作网站公司心雨在线高端网站建设专业
  • 山西做网站如何选择2万元最简单装修
  • 广丰区建设局网站友情链接发布网
  • 沧州做网站的专业公司python做网站视频
  • 管理外贸网站模板下载大数据营销优势
  • 做网站的小图标硬盘做网站空间
  • 微信网站界面设计宁波网站优化公司推荐
  • 深圳商城网站开发七冶建设集团网站
  • 广州旅游网站建设设计公司wordpress长文章分页代码
  • 手机营销网站网站的字体
  • 设计网站大全软件互动营销用在哪些推广上面
  • 建设银行网站怎样查询贷款信息吗台州网站制作 外贸
  • 建设网站的步骤知乎app开发定制公司
  • 怎样自己做刷赞网站专业网站设计服务
  • 云主机建站如何让自己做的博客网站上线
  • 目前我们的网站正在建设中做网站违反广告法
  • 有没有做美食的规模网站怎么做国外的网站吗
  • 竭诚网络网站建设开发杭州百度推广
  • 怎样购买起名软件自己做网站小程序制作收费
  • 制作企业网站欢迎界面素材cuntlove wordpress
  • 适合建设网站的国外服务器人工智能培训机构
  • 怎么套网站潜江资讯网招聘信息
  • 网站建设 微信公众号建设网站需要